Wouldn't it just be easier to get a spacer plate made up with injector cut outs to fit the EFI inlet manifold to the MFI head and then have a CPS hole tapped into the block along with the swap to a EFI flywheel (you can grab these off of any CVH EFI engine, FRST, XR2i 8v, XR3i EFI, Orion mk4/5 EFI 1.6 CVH etc.) rather than using a Sierra CPS? It's just that I thought using the Sierra CPS would require the spacing out of the alternator bracket itself? (I had to have this done by Gadget with my Cossie management conversion).
